Carstairs is a quiet locality in Queensland within the Burdekin local government area (postcode 4806). With a population of 91, the suburb has a mature demographic with a median age of 52. Households earn a median income of $115K per year, with an average household size of 2.5 people. The most common occupations are managers, professionals, technicians & trades. The top ancestries reported are Australian, English, Italian.
The median weekly rent is $175 (Census 2021). The median monthly mortgage repayment is $1,155.
The crime rate in the Burdekin LGA is moderate at 4,605 incidents per 100,000 population.
